Assessee has option to choose initial from which it may desire to claim Section 80IA deduction for ten consecutive years

March 31, 2021 1347 Views 0 comment Print

CIT Vs Tamil Nadu Newsprint and Papers Limited (Madras High court) It is abundantly clear from Sub-Section (2) of Section 80IA that an assessee who is eligible to claim deduction u/s 80IA has the option to choose the initial/first year from which it may desire the claim of deduction for ten consecutive years, out of […]

GST on Quality material testing & Geophysical survey investigation

March 31, 2021 9714 Views 0 comment Print

The services provided by the applicant, namely, Quality material testing works is not exempted from Goods and Services Tax in terms of entry no.3 of the Notification 12/2017- Central Tax (rate) dated 28.06.2017 as amended and The service of Geophysical survey investigation is exempted from Goods and service Tax terms of entry no.3 of the Notification 12/2017- Central Tax (rate) dated 28.06.2017 subject to conditions stated in Para 9.7 above.
